14:22 — Offline sync regression confirmed (Terrapath field-survey app)

At 14:22 the on-call engineer reproduced the data-loss path: surveys saved while offline were marked synced once connectivity returned, even when the upload was rejected. The queue flush skipped the server acknowledgement check introduced in the previous sprint. Release manager note: the fix must ship before the coastal survey season. The offending build is identified by the token recorded below.

session token of kawif-fawig = htk31_f3f599be2b1a34affb1efa8d0feccf8

Scheduling in Sproutly is deliberately lazy: the core just asks each plugin "when does this plant next need water?" and merges the answers. Plugins shouldn't poll soil sensors themselves — the Drizzlebus feed handles that and debounces noisy readings. If your plugin returns conflicting times, the earliest wins. The debounce and merge behavior is governed by these constants.

tuning constants:
QUOTAS = {
    "druwyn": 5,
    "holix": 5,
    "zorath": 5,
    "holwyn": 10,
}

## Configuration

Plugins targeting the Vexlo firmware update channel must declare a channel tier (`stable`, `canary`, or `hotfix`) in `plugin.toml`. The Vexlo updater refuses unsigned manifests; signing happens server-side, so your plugin only supplies the channel and a rollout percentage. Keep rollout below 20% for canary builds. All channel operations authenticate against the Vexlo relay, which reads credentials from your `.env` file. Add the following line to `.env` before publishing.

env line for fafof-fahag: LEDGER_TOKEN5=f8790